    I finally took some time to organize my sound effects library. When I open a project from a few weeks ago, I am prompted to re-link some of the SFX files since they have moved. I click on “Locate” (using Media Browser to locate files) and the Media Browser just says “Reading …” but never lists what is in that folder. Sometimes it will let me click on another folder in the left column, then just “Reading …” again. Most of the time it eventually crashes PP. I cleaned out the media cache files and reset preferences by holding down option when launching PP.

    I need to make some revisions to this project today. Any ideas?

    PP 13.1.5 (Build 47)
    High Sierra
    QNAP NAS
